If you're referring to Pokemon Showdown, we pick formats out of our existing pool of Other Metagames each month. The formats that get picked become available to play on Pokemon Showdown's ladder for the month following. Two formats are picked total. One by the OM community (OM of the Month) and one by OM leadership (Leader's Choice).

Water Shuriken is 30 base power minimum, but has a good chance to be 45, 60, or 75 base power. And unlike Aqua Jet, Water Shuriken breaks Substitutes, allowing Mega Gyarados to revenge kill Pokemon like Primal Groudon and Mega Diancie behind a Substitute. It also breaks Focus Sashes which is helpful for threatening ultra frail Pokemon like Deoxys-Attack or No Guard users like Mega Aerodactyl.why does huge power m-gyarados run water shuriken over aqua jet in oras ph?
